India strongly condemns the terrorist attack on Sayed al-Shuhada Girls school in Kabul


Like, Share, Comment…be the Voice of Free Press

The India Observer, TIO, Washington, DC, May 09, 2021: We strongly condemn the terrorist attack on Sayed al-Shuhada Girls school in Kabul yesterday, which killed more than 50 innocent girl students during the holy month of Ramadan. Our thoughts and prayers are with the families and friends of the young girls who lost their lives in this barbarous attack.

Targeting young girl students makes this an attack on the future of Afghanistan. The perpetrators clearly seek to destroy the painstaking and hard-won achievements that the Afghans have put in place over the last two decades.

This incident demonstrates, once again, the urgent need for dismantling terrorist sanctuaries and the immediate need for a comprehensive nationwide ceasefire to make the peace process meaningful and sustainable.

India has always supported the education of Afghan youth and remains committed to the progress and development of Afghanistan.
